Section 15-96 - Appeal to Public Utilities Regulatory Authority

If any corporation subject to regulation by the Public Utilities Regulatory Authority is aggrieved by the adoption of airport zoning regulations under section 15-91 or by refusal to grant a variance permit as provided in subsection (b) of section 15-93, such corporation, within thirty days after such adoption or refusal, may appeal to said authority, and if, after notice and hearing, said authority determines that the public safety, necessity and convenience will be best served by the amendment or annulment of such regulation, it may order such regulation to be amended or annulled, or may grant a variance permit as prescribed in said subsection (b).
